Basement of Touki's Residence.

With extreme concentration and moving her hands at high speed, Suki fluidly executes a veritable dance of hands to form the different hand seals intended for one of the latest programs designed by Touki. They are both in their usual working position, with her sitting on his lap, executing each of the seals necessary to achieve the magic that only they are capable of, guided only by a blackboard full of strange symbols, as a reminder of the program's composition.

After hundreds, perhaps thousands, of hand seals, the work is completed with a sigh from Suki and a quick movement from Touki, implanting the code into a metal plate hanging in front of them. The magic happens immediately, and countless symbols scroll across the artifact, then disappear, leaving a faint mark on the metal surface.

The tension drains from Suki's body, causing her to collapse in the man's arms, exclaiming, "We did it, Master."

"That's right, Suki," Touki says softly, letting his arms fall and resting his forehead on her shoulder, "With this, we complete this important project. I want to congratulate you for not slipping up on any occasion today... So, as promised, dinner tonight is whatever you want."

A smile forms on the young woman's face, and she simply settles into the man's lap before saying, "Let me rest for a moment like this."

The man lifts his head, letting Suki's back rest against his chest. "You're feeling peculiarly affectionate today. Why is that?"

"I don't know," Suki replies, still smiling, then puts on a thoughtful expression. "Perhaps it's due to the sudden romantic atmosphere Naruto and Hinata have created in the store. I wonder who's to blame?"

"Cough… I don't know what you're talking about. Are you trying to seduce me?" Touki comments, caressing her head with one of his hands.

Suki takes the man's other hand in her own and begins to play with his fingers. "I think that's impossible. The master doesn't seem to think of me that way. He doesn't even take me on his explorations to other worlds… maybe he's already kissing Izumi in fantasy worlds like fairy tales."

Touki's face tightens, and he can't help but smile bittersweetly, "In order to accompany me, Suki must put in all her effort and fully master her new eyes, otherwise I'll be forced to continue excluding her."

"Then Suki will resort to a strike and will no longer perform hand seals," she complains, pretending to be angry, but at the same time clasping her hand with his.

Suddenly, Touki's face turns serious, saying in a soft but firm voice, "Suki, I can't return your feelings right now."

The smile disappears from her face, but her hand continues to squeeze his. "Why?"

The man is silent for a few moments, then says bitterly, "Because I'm an idiot, lost in my delusions of grandeur, who doesn't know if I really want to love a woman like that… Because I'm afraid of ruining everything and leading you or someone else into a relationship filled with pain, especially when we're involved in a field filled with death… Who knows when one of us will end up psychologically too damaged or simply dead?"

"That's not what you told Naruto about how a strong man should behave," she complains.

"That's because I'm a hypocrite and because I'm far from a strong man. Without my armor and artifacts, I'm nothing. You, Tomomi, Izumi, and practically anyone in the Order can kick my ass under those conditions."

Suki makes a slightly angry face, removing her blindfold and standing up. She then turns around and stares at the man, her eyes red and her brow furrowed. Then, to Touki's surprise, she delivers a well-aimed punch to his face, directly in his eye.

"What the…" the man tries to say, but is interrupted by another punch. At first, he doesn't seem able to respond, but soon, he manages to grab her wrists, and everything turns into a struggle on the ground, with both of them trying to gain the upper hand.

"Don't ever say you're not a strong man," Suki exclaims, tears in her eyes. "I won't let anyone speak ill of my master, not even you."

Touki puts on a conflicted face, doing his best to control her, who begins to cry uncontrollably. Finally, she stops resisting, and he holds her, hugging her tightly. He then says, "Please bear with me. Your master isn't perfect… Let me finish off those who threaten this world, and if you still have feelings for me after all this, I promise I'll make you my wife."

"Really?" Suki murmurs softly, pressing her face against his chest.

"I promise," the man replies, seriously and decisively, "But I also need you to promise me that you won't insist on accompanying me on my travels to other worlds until you completely control those eyes… And I also want you to always prioritize your safety and Karin's before mine. It's the only way I'll be able to rest easy, doing what I have to do."

"I will, if you never show me that pessimistic side of yourself again… You are the most important person to many, and you can't think that way. Your artifacts are part of your strength and the strength of everyone in the Divine Order; no one will ever question that," she says decisively, in contrast to her tear-filled eyes.

Touki simply smiles and kisses Suki on the forehead, letting her hold him for as long as she wants, something that ends up lasting for over an hour when he realizes she's fallen asleep.

The man stares at the ceiling for a long time, completely lost in his thoughts, using a healing device to prevent the bruise from appearing on his eye, before getting up and carrying Suki like a princess to her room.

He then heads to the kitchen and makes himself a coffee with milk and plenty of sugar, but just as he's about to take the first sip, Karin appears from the doorway, her face quite troubled.

"Nii-san, I have a problem," the girl says in the sweetest, gentlest voice possible.

Touki makes a face of extreme pain, sets the cup on the table, and puts both hands to his face. "For the love of god... What's wrong, Karin? You never call me ni-san."

"I had a little conflict at the academy…"

"Conflict?"

"...Let's just say a fight... and our sensei called our parents... or in my case, legal guardian," the girl says, very embarrassed.

"Did something happen to you? Are you hurt?" Touki reacts, examining the girl carefully for injuries.

"Not at all, it's just that I got a little carried away and ended up hitting several of my classmates," the girl's voice is filled with nervousness.

The man seems to understand where the conversation is going, but still asks in a rather serious voice, "Classmates? Plural?"

Karin simply smiles awkwardly and hands a note to the man, who, after reading it, simply stares at the girl for a long time, before sighing in defeat…
